Overview of CLEVAST Moisture Absorber Boxes and wisedry Silica Gel Packets
When it comes to controlling humidity in enclosed spaces, the CLEVAST Moisture Absorber Boxes and wisedry Silica Gel Packets offer two distinct approaches. The CLEVAST product is a pack of six dehumidifiers designed for various spaces, while wisedry provides ten silica gel packets that can be reactivated in a microwave. Both products serve to combat excess moisture, but they cater to different needs and preferences.
Effectiveness in Moisture Control
The CLEVAST Moisture Absorber Boxes utilize spherical calcium chloride particles to attract and absorb moisture quickly. Each box can hold a significant amount of moisture and provides control for up to 60 days, making it a long-lasting option for spaces like closets and bathrooms. In contrast, wisedry's silica gel packets absorb moisture up to 35% of their weight and are designed for quick reactivation in the microwave, requiring only 2 minutes to dry out. This makes wisedry ideal for users who need a rapid solution for smaller, enclosed spaces.

Ease of Use
CLEVAST Moisture Absorber Boxes require no assembly and can be placed anywhere moisture is a concern. Each box is individually packaged, which facilitates easy storage and use. On the other hand, wisedry's silica gel packets are hermetically sealed, ensuring they remain dry until used. The inclusion of a ziplock bag for storage also adds convenience. While both products are easy to use, CLEVAST offers a more straightforward solution with its ready-to-use boxes.
Versatility of Application
When it comes to versatility, the CLEVAST Moisture Absorber Boxes can be used in a variety of spaces, including basements, kitchens, bathrooms, and even vehicles. They are designed to tackle humidity issues in larger areas effectively. Conversely, the wisedry silica gel packets are better suited for smaller, enclosed spaces, such as drawers or containers. This makes the CLEVAST option more adaptable for different environments, while wisedry is ideal for more targeted applications.
Monitoring Moisture Levels
CLEVAST Moisture Absorber Boxes allow users to visibly monitor the dehumidification process, as the accumulated moisture can be observed in the bottom of the box. This feature enables users to gauge when to replace or dispose of the boxes. In contrast, wisedry offers moisture-indicating beads that change color when saturated, providing a quick visual cue on when the packets need recharging. This feature of wisedry enhances its usability but may require more frequent attention compared to the CLEVAST product.
Safety and Health Considerations
CLEVAST emphasizes safety with its fragrance-free moisture absorbers, making them suitable for various indoor environments without introducing unwanted scents. The wisedry silica gel packets are made from food-grade silica gel, ensuring safety for use around food and pharmaceuticals. However, it is crucial to note that while wisedry’s silica gel is safe, it still requires careful handling to prevent accidental ingestion, especially in households with small children or pets.
